1. TACTICS: What is the tactical importance of a prayer base? A prayer base becomes the tactical position from which the Kingdom of God is advanced in a nation or nations. It is the most necessary spiritual place to be won in God before evangelization begins.
2. TOOLS: How is the base won? It is won through physically being in the nation to “walk the land.” As the Lord said to Joshua: “Every place that the sole of your foot shall tread upon, that have I given unto you, as I said unto Moses” (Joshua 1:3). It is won through the tools of prayer, the prophetic Word, worship, and warfare.
3. TASK: What is the assignment? We are to establish an “open heaven” over the area assigned. The base or hub, once won, will become “Divine Headquarters.” God’s directives for all evangelistic activity will flow from this base.
4. TERMINATION: What is the end result of an “open heaven?” An open heaven results in an open channel of communication between God and man (Genesis 28:12, 2 Samuel 22:10, Nehemiah 9:13, Psalm 144:5). This area will be our “heavenly point of contact.” It provides direct access to God leading to His active intervention in response to our intercession.
5. TEAMS: Who is sent to establish a prayer base? Why? Mature, modern day prophets, apostles, and prophetic intercessors are sent by God to the nations to establish this work. A new work in God, which this is, is built on the foundation of prophets and apostles (Ephesians 2:20).
6. TRAITS: What characteristics must these people possess in order to be sent by God? This task requires integrity and personal holiness. One must be able to walk in darkness and dispel it; then stand, covered with the precious blood of Jesus, to intercede before the very throne of God. To be able to do this, those who are sent must have “clean hands,” a “pure heart,” and be free from pride and deceit (Psalm 24:3,4).
